| Baseball-Highlights of Friday's MLB games Friday, Apr 26, 2013 08:58 PM PDT April 26 (SportsDirect) - Highlights of Friday's Major League Baseball games - - - Nationals 1, Reds 0 Jordan Zimmerman threw a one-hitter for his first career shutout as host Washington got its second straight dominant pitching performance against Cincinnati. One night after Gio Gonzalez let up one hit - a home run - in eight innings of an 8-1 Washington victory, Zimmerman (4-1) allowed a third-inning single to Xavier Paul and retired 14 of the last 15 men he faced. Zimmerman struck out four and threw 91 pitches in improving to 3-0 with a 1.36 ERA against the Reds. ... Full Story | Top |

| NBA-Highlights of Friday's NBA playoff games Friday, Apr 26, 2013 08:03 PM PDT April 26 (SportsDirect) - Highlights of Friday's National Basketball Association playoff games - - - Knicks 90, Celtics 76 Carmelo Anthony scored 26 points as the visiting New York Knicks took a commanding 3-0 lead in the Eastern Conference playoff series against Boston. Raymond Felton had 15 points and 10 assists and J.R. Smith added 15 points before he was ejected in the fourth quarter as the second-seeded Knicks moved within a win of a series sweep. Game Four in the best-of-seven series is on Sunday in Boston. ... Full Story | Top |

| NBA-Another blow for injury-hit Lakers with Nash out Friday, Apr 26, 2013 07:26 PM PDT By Mark Lamport-Stokes LOS ANGELES, April 26 (Reuters) - The ailing Los Angeles Lakers faced an even tougher task against the San Antonio Spurs in Friday's Game Three when veteran guard Steve Nash was ruled out shortly before the tipoff because of back and hip problems. With Nash on the sidelines, the Lakers will field the relatively inexperienced Darius Morris and Andrew Goudelock as starting guards as they bid to claw their way back from a 2-0 deficit in their best-of-seven first-round playoff series. ... | Chinese prodigy Guan again a cut above Friday, Apr 26, 2013 06:05 PM PDT (Reuters) - Two weeks after stunning the golfing world by making the cut at the Masters, China's 14-year-old Guan Tianlang has again turned heads with another remarkable display at the Zurich Classic of New Orleans in Avondale, Louisiana. The surprisingly mature eighth-grader carded a three-under-par 69 in Friday's second round of the PGA Tour event to finish at three-under 141, right on the cutline. ... Full Story | Top |

| NFL-San Diego Chargers pick Te'o in second round of NFL Draft Friday, Apr 26, 2013 05:54 PM PDT NEW YORK, April 26 (Reuters) - Manti Te'o was selected by the San Diego Chargers in the second round of the National Football League (NFL) annual Draft on Friday, ending an anxious wait for one of the game's most scrutinised and controversial players. Te'o was a notable absentee when the NFL's 32 teams made their first-round selections the previous night but he was the sixth man picked when the second of the seven rounds got underway in New York on Friday. ... | Glover leads by one, Guan makes cut Friday, Apr 26, 2013 05:50 PM PDT (Reuters) - While Chinese prodigy Guan Tianlang stunningly made his second consecutive cut on the PGA Tour, American Lucas Glover surged into a one-shot lead in Friday's second round of the Zurich Classic of New Orleans. Former U.S. Open champion Glover maintained red-hot form with his putter at the rain-softened TPC Louisiana, firing a five-under-par 67 after teeing off on a relatively calm morning in Avondale, Louisiana. ...
